Why E-E-A-T Matters for Healthcare SEO in 2026
E-E-A-T is Google’s framework for assessing content quality, especially for YMYL content like healthcare, where accuracy and trust are critical. In 2026, Google’s algorithms, including SGE, prioritize content demonstrating:
- Experience: First-hand knowledge from qualified professionals.
- Expertise: Deep insights from credentialed authors.
- Authoritativeness: Recognition within the healthcare industry.
- Trustworthiness: Transparent, reliable, and secure content.

What are the key E‑E‑A‑T strategies for effective healthcare SEO?
To enhance medical SEO in 2026, medical practices should adopt these E-E-A-T-focused strategies:
1. Showcase Experience and Expertise
Google’s updated E-E-A-T guidelines emphasize firsthand experience. For healthcare, this
means content authored or reviewed by licensed medical professionals. Highlighting credentials, certifications, and real-world experience builds credibility.
Implementation Tip:
- Include detailed author bios for physicians, linking to their professional profiles (e.g., LinkedIn or Healthgrades).
- Publish case studies or anonymized patient success stories (HIPAA-compliant) to demonstrate expertise.

2. Build Authoritativeness with Citations and Backlinks
Authoritativeness comes from being recognized as a healthcare leader. Google values content linked to reputable sources and cited by authoritative websites.
Implementation Tip:
- Partner with trusted platforms like WebMD or Mayo Clinic for guest posts or citations.
- Publish research-based articles on topics like “telemedicine advancements” and submit them to medical journals or directories.

3. Enhance Trustworthiness with Trust Signals
Trust signals, such as patient reviews, secure websites, and transparent information, are vital for YMYL content. In 2026, Google’s SGE prioritizes sites with strong trust indicators for AI search rankings.
Implementation Tip:
- Display verified patient reviews in search results using structured data.
- Ensure the website is HTTPS-secure and includes clear contact information, privacy policies, and HIPAA compliance statements.
- Highlight accreditations, like those from the Joint Commission, to reinforce trust.
4. Optimize for Google’s SGE and AI Overviews
Google’s SGE changes how healthcare content is surfaced, with AI-generated answers pulling from E-E-A-T-compliant sources. To rank in AI Overviews, content must be concise, authoritative, and structured for semantic SEO.
Implementation Tip:
- Address common patient queries like “What is hypertension?” or “How to prepare for surgery?” with FAQ content.
- Structure content with clear headings, bullet points, and concise paragraphs for AI parsing.

How can Healthcare Brands Adapt to 2026 Trends in Content Marketing?
Several trends will shape E-E-A-T and healthcare SEO in 2026:
1. Voice Search and Conversational Queries
With voice assistants like Siri and Google Assistant driving healthcare searches, content must address conversational queries like “Who is the best pediatrician in [city]?” Optimizing for natural language and E-E-A-T signals ensures visibility.
Actionable Step: Create content that answers long-tail, question-based keywords and optimize it for voice search.
2. Video and Visual Content
Video content is a powerful trust signal that showcases physician expertise and patient education. Google’s algorithms increasingly prioritize video in AI Overviews and rich results.
Actionable Step: Produce short, informative videos on topics like “managing chronic pain” and optimize them for search.
3. Local SEO Integration
E-E-A-T complements local SEO for doctors. Practices must align their Google Business Profiles, website content, and trust signals to dominate local search.
Actionable Step: Ensure NAP (Name, Address, Phone Number) consistency and optimize for local search.
What are the most common E‑E‑A‑T pitfalls to avoid in SEO?
To maintain content authority, avoid these mistakes:
- Unverified Authors: Content not authored or reviewed by qualified professionals risks penalties.
- Thin Content: Generic or shallow content fails to meet E-E-A-T standards. Focus on in-depth, evidence-based articles.
- Neglecting Updates: Outdated medical information erodes trust. Regularly audit content for accuracy.
What tools and resources can help achieve E‑E‑A‑T compliance in SEO?
Use these tools to align with E-E-A-T:
- Google Search Console: Monitor performance and identify YMYL content issues.
- Yoast SEO: Optimize content for semantic SEO and readability.
- Ahrefs: Track backlinks and authoritative citations to boost content authority.
How can you measure E‑E‑A‑T success?
Track these metrics to evaluate E-E-A-T impact:
- Organic Traffic: Monitor traffic from healthcare-related keywords using Google Analytics.
- AI Overview Appearances: Note increases in question-based query traffic.
- Local Rankings: Track rankings for “doctor in [city]” using tools like BrightLocal.
